Obverse descriptionA genius writes `HUMAN RIGHTS` on a massive table. This motif, borrowed from Augustin Dupré, is surrounded by the inscription `RÉPUBLIQUE FRANÇAISE` (FRENCH REPUBLIC).
Obverse scriptLatin
Obverse letteringRÉPUBLIQUE FRANÇAISE D`AP. DUPRÉ
